How Our Team Handles Kitchen Water Removal
Our process starts with a thorough assessment of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ak and develop a plan to dry out the affected area. Our team will use specialized equipment to extract water and dry the space, reducing the risk of further damage or mold growth.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ive within 60 minutes of your call to assess the damage and develop a plan to dry out your kitchen. Our team will identify the source of the leak and find out the best course of action.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from the affected area,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to dry out the space and prevent further moisture buildup.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your kitchen is safe to use.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ect all surfaces and materials to prevent the spread of bacteria and mold. This step is essential in ensuring your kitchen is safe to use and preventing further damage.
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
We’ll make any necessary repairs to damaged surfaces, including flooring, walls, and cabinets. Our team will work closely with you to ensure the final result meets your expectations.

Kitchen Water Removal Cost in Richwood, TX
The cost of Kitchen Water Removal in Richwood,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the job.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ces |
| Restoration and repairs |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, type of materials |
